Obsession & Possession

Contributed by ravenblack_phoenix on Tuesday, 29th April 2003 @ 01:05:00 PM in AEST
Topic: DreamsandWishes



Daydreams of eternal love..
Remember, nothing endures forever…
My heart sighs in sadness,
But the visions will not sever.
And now my heart is tainted,
But by something so melodic,
Or madness..?

Oh, but my body yearns so badly..
My soul cries so for your kiss..
While my heart sings so sadly,
Crying for the enchanting touch of your very caress...
How it's etched into my memory,
Engraved into my very soul...
And these longings for you,
I now know, I can no longer control;
For this drug you’ve given me carries me too swiftly,
Towards the very brim of obsession,
Too sweet to calm when you simply kiss me,
Me, merely wishing to be your only possession…
